Poor etiquette?
Live 20/40 Stud at the Commerce
Great game. A few ridiculous fish and the rest mostly mediocre regulars. A few decent players occasionally, usually waiting for the 30 game. As it was getting past 4 in the morning, I had already decided this was going to be my last hand. If you knowingly do this it is wrong. But alot of people don't think "I have Aces, so I have the best pair" They think "I have a pair...I hope it's better than his pair". Just like lots of people dont think "when I call what do I have to beat" They think "Ohh..I have Qs I call".
so depending on who did this you shouldn't worry about it |

If the other guy is oblivious, he might not be aware that you couldn't also have Aces. I've seen folks who play $30/60 regularly lose sight of the fact that there are four Aces in the deck.
If he was aware of what he was doing, it is poor etiquette. So what? If you're going to let stuff like this bother you, don't play live. The river bet was probably not your best move. |

[ QUOTE ]
The river bet was probably not your best move. [/ QUOTE ] I think it's one of those "bluff value bets" in that I could get called by a smaller pair or I could get him to fold aces. He was pretty close to folding. I'm also very unlikely to get raised, and it'd probably be safe to fold in that case. If I were to check/call, I think I might have to make a digusting overcall if P1 bets and P2 calls, just because P2 was so retarded that he would probably call with any pair there unless there is a bet and a call (or raise) in front of him. But most likely it would get checked through. It might be the case that check/folding is the best option since I didn't improve. |
